WebWhen the atoms linked by a covalent bond are different, the bonding electrons are shared, but no longer equally. Instead, the bonding electrons are more attracted to one atom than the other, giving rise to a shift of electron density toward that atom. WebFor example, two chlorine atoms, which each seek an eighth electron in their outer shell, can share an electron in what is known as a covalent bond to form chlorine gas (Cl 2) (Figure 2.2.2). Electrons are shared in a covalent bond. Figure 2.2.2 Depiction of a covalent bond between two chlorine atoms. WebChlorine atoms are covalently bonded to form a diatomic Cl 2 molecule. Cl 2 Lewis structure consists of two chlorine atoms linked by a single bond with three lone pairs on each chlorine. Two atoms form a covalent chemical bond by each sharing at least one of their available valence electrons. The valence electron count for each isolated neutral atom is derived from the corresponding element's position in the periodic table.
